From 60ab5563850587967bc93e5a368e81382ac79de1 Mon Sep 17 00:00:00 2001 From: robert-hh Date: Tue, 24 Jan 2023 11:23:47 +0100 Subject: [PATCH] samd/mcu: Rework the comments in clock_config.c. For more clarity. clock_config.c is not overly readable, so comments are important. --- ports/samd/mcu/samd21/clock_config.c | 25 +++++++++++++++---------- ports/samd/mcu/samd51/clock_config.c | 16 ++++++++++------ 2 files changed, 25 insertions(+), 16 deletions(-) diff --git a/ports/samd/mcu/samd21/clock_config.c b/ports/samd/mcu/samd21/clock_config.c index 00f743cc49d1..ae8441b7caf0 100644 --- a/ports/samd/mcu/samd21/clock_config.c +++ b/ports/samd/mcu/samd21/clock_config.c @@ -135,13 +135,18 @@ void init_clocks(uint32_t cpu_freq) { dfll48m_calibration = 0; // please the compiler // SAMD21 Clock settings - // GCLK0: 48MHz from DFLL open loop mode or closed loop mode from 32k Crystal - // GCLK1: 32768 Hz from 32K ULP or DFLL48M - // GCLK2: 48MHz from DFLL for Peripherals - // GCLK3: 1Mhz for the us-counter (TC4/TC5) - // GCLK4: 32kHz from crystal, if present - // GCLK5: 48MHz from DFLL for USB - // GCLK8: 1kHz clock for WDT and RTC + // + // GCLK0: 48MHz, source: DFLL48M, usage: CPU + // GCLK1: 32kHz, source: XOSC32K or OSCULP32K or DFLL48M, usage: FDPLL96M reference + // GCLK2: 1-48MHz, source: DFLL48M, usage: Peripherals + // GCLK3: 1Mhz, source: DFLL48M, usage: us-counter (TC4/TC5) + // GCLK4: 32kHz, source: XOSC32K, if crystal present, usage: DFLL48M reference + // GCLK5: 48MHz, source: DFLL48M, usage: USB + // GCLK8: 1kHz, source: XOSC32K or OSCULP32K, usage: WDT and RTC + // DFLL48M: Reference sources: + // - in closed loop mode: eiter XOSC32K or OSCULP32K or USB clock + // - in open loop mode: None + // FDPLL96M: Not used (yet). Option to use it for the CPU clock.
